Questions about rs2242882
What is rs2242882?
rs2242882 is a single position in the genome, in or near the RUNX1 gene. Published research associates it with brain-derived neurotrophic factor levels. A single variant does not decide an outcome — it shifts a probability, and for most common variants the shift is small.
Does having rs2242882 mean I will get this?
No. Common variants like this one move a probability slightly and, on their own, rarely decide anything about one person. Nothing on this page is a diagnosis, and health decisions should be made with a clinician who can see your whole picture.
